Can Toe Hardness Post Recovery From A Snake Bite Be Cured?

Hello, Three weeks ago I was bitten by a copperhead. I was treated at the emergency room and spent two days in the hospital. Everything is going well except for my big toe (where I was bitten) had a blister which is black and now has dried up and is very hard. What should I do to make my toe normal again? Thanks, Diane

General Surgeon 's  Response
Hi and welcome to Healthcaremagic. Thank you for your query. I am Dr. Rommstein and I will try to help you as much as I can.If this is toe necrosis then it will not recover and it should be ampuatted. If there is still vital toe then it may be saved but stifness and swelling may persist.
